At 60,000 miles, the recommended service for a Honda Odyssey typically includes a comprehensive inspection and maintenance of key components. This often involves an oil change, replacing the engine air filter, checking and possibly replacing the cabin air filter, inspecting the brakes, tires, and suspension, and flushing the Transmission Fluid. It's also a good time to check the coolant and Power Steering fluid levels, as well as the condition of the belts and hoses. Always refer to the owner's manual for specific recommendations tailored to your model year.
